Carrying Worship to Monday

Discipleship S.T.E.P.S.: Worship God

Scripture: Exalt the Lord our God, and worship at his holy hill; for the Lord our God is holy. – Psalm 99:9 (KJV)

Worship is not a performance for Sunday morning, but an orientation of the heart that prepares us for every challenge the coming week may hold. When we exalt the Lord, we acknowledge His holiness and majesty, putting our personal stresses into the correct perspective. Preparing your heart today is about setting a trajectory for your week that prioritizes His presence above your personal agenda.

As you enter into worship, let your heart be cleansed by the recognition of His glory. A heart prepared for God is one that remains in a state of worship even as the weekend ends. Carry this reverence into your Monday morning; by keeping your focus on the holy hill of God, you will find that your strength is renewed and your perspective is fortified for whatever duties lay before you.
